Frequently Asked Questions about Miami Beach

How much are Studio apartments in Miami Beach?

There are currently 1,246 Studio Apartments in Miami Beach with rent ranges from $1,190 to $15,408 with an average price of $2,518.

What is the current price range for One Bedroom Miami Beach Apartments for rent?

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Miami Beach ranges from $1,399 to $14,424 with an average monthly rent of $3,108.

What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Miami Beach cost?

The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Miami Beach range from $1,333 to $14,246.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$4,091.

How expensive are Miami Beach Three Bedroom Apartments?

There are currently 263 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Miami Beach on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$2,300 to $30,000 - averaging $6,283 for the location.
